# Java ByteBuffer 编码设置指南 在Java中,`ByteBuffer` 是处理字节数组的强大工具,广泛应用于网络编程和文件IO操作等场景。对于一个刚入行的小白来说,理解 `ByteBuffer` 的编码设置流程是非常重要的。本文将详细介绍如何实现 Java `ByteBuffer` 编码设置,包括一个明确的流程图、每一步的具体操作和必要的代码示例。 ## 流程概述 在开始之
原创 9月前
24阅读
# Java中的ByteBuffer和dump操作详解 在Java编程中,ByteBuffer是一个非常常用的类,用于处理字节数据的缓冲区。它提供了一系列方法来进行字节的读取和写入操作,并且还支持dump操作,可以将缓冲区中的数据以十六进制的形式输出。本文将详细介绍Java中的ByteBuffer类以及如何进行dump操作,并提供相应的代码示例。 ## ByteBuffer类简介 ByteB
原创 2024-02-02 07:08:00
28阅读
ByteBuff 二进制编解码
原创 2024-08-23 15:26:59
11阅读
这不会那样.请记住,JAVE只是充当ffmpeg可执行文件的包装器,那就是你提供参数,比如目标编码,响度等等然后基本上告诉JAVE调用fmpeg并传递设置,你输入了使用Java方法作为ffmpeg可执行文件的参数.此步骤需要您指定的设置1.可序列化2.已知ffmpeg可执行文件现在你可以争论至少一些InputStream,比如FileInputStream以某种方式可序列化,因为有一个低级别的文件
转载 2023-10-07 19:16:42
230阅读
Java IO 基础知识笔记Java IO1.编码问题1.1中文机器上创建的文件只能识别ansi编码1.2 utf-8编码汉字占3个字节,英文字符占1个字节1.3 gbk编码 汉字占2个字节,英文占1个字节1.4 utf-16be编码java中的编码,汉字和英文都占两个自己1.5. .getBytes() 将字符串编程byte类型1.6. integer.toHexString() 将字节流编程
eclipse中怎么设置编码或是默认编码呢?本节内容中小编就为大家带来eclipse设置编码教程,下面就不妨来了解一下吧!eclipse设置编码教程如果要使插件开发应用能有更好的国际化支持,能够最大程度的支持中文输出,则最好使 Java文件使用UTF-8编码。然而,Eclipse工 作空间(workspace)的缺省字符编码是操作系统缺省的编码,简体中文操作系统 (Windows XP、Windo
转载 2023-09-11 20:07:06
70阅读
一、 判断一个文本文件的编码方式按照给定的字符集存储文本文件时,在文件的最开头的三个字节中就有可能存储着编码信息,所以,基本的原理就是只要读出文件前三个字节,判定这些字节的值,就可以得知其编码的格式。  二、 问题使用Windows记事本的“另存为”,可以在GBK、Unicode、Unicode big endian和UTF-8这几种编码方式间相互转换。同样是txt文件,Win
Java阿里规范      无规矩不成方圆,同样在编码时也要遵循一定的规范,因为就会成为面试过程中的必问点,而大多数就以阿里的规范为主,近期看了文档做一个记录,相当于一个建议的阿里规范; 文章目录Java阿里规范1、编程规范1.1 命名风格1.2 常量定义1.3 代码格式1.4 OOP规约1.5 日期时间1.6 集合处理1.7 并发处理1
Java IO 知识思维导图一、字符、字节、位(bit)1 字符占用的字节数是不一定的,如果是 UTF-8 编码: 1 字符 = 2 字节 1 字节 = 8 位基本数据类型关系如下:类型占用字节占用位数byte18short216int432long864float432double864char216boolean18一、UTF-8、UTF-16、GBK 编码java 使用的字符集是 unico
转载 2023-11-14 10:40:02
70阅读
一、编码知识1、gbk编码:中文占用两个字节,英文占用一个字节2、utf-8编码:中文占用三个字节,英文占用一个字节3、utf-16be编码Java默认编码方式):中文占两个字节,英文占两个字节,所以Java被称为双字节编码方式4、当字节流用某种编码编译时,解析也要用同一种编码解析,不然会出现乱码状况 二、java.io.File类的基本认识1、File只能用于表示文件(目录)的信息(
过程分析:第一步:java文件编码格式    文件格式非固定:     Java文件在编写之前需要指定文件的编码格式,默认编码和当前操作系统平台编码保持一致。比如,当前操作系统平台为windows中文版,那么编码一般为GBK。当然可以对保存文件的编码进行修改。例如修改成UTF-8。那么此时文件保存的编码就为UTF-8。第二步:j
转载 2023-06-17 19:47:27
2750阅读
IO是Java中的一块比较重要的知识,在日常开发中应用广泛,现对Java IO知识进行整理归纳。在IO之前呢,用几篇文章介绍一下Java中的编码以及File类的基本使用。本篇文章先来简单介绍编码。为了更直观的解释各种编码以及对他们进行比较我们用几个简单的例子来说明。代码1/** * 测试不同的编码格式,为方便显示,将字节序列以16进制形式显示,并且输出只显示有效的低8位 * 具体方式是Inte
编码是信息从一种形式或格式转换为另一种形式的过程,也称为计算机编程语言的代码简称编码。用预先规定的方法将文字、数字或其它对象编成数码,或将信息、数据转换成规定的电脉冲信号。编码在电子计算机、电视、遥控和通讯等方面广泛使用。编码是信息从一种形式或格式转换为另一种形式的过程。解码,是编码的逆过程。自己的理解 (简单来说就是每个国家的语言不一样,所以编程时会有语言差异,比如计算机在国外发展的比较早,所以
1.在Java 中,String的默认编码格式是unicode。 Java内部字符串String用得都是是Unicode编码,所以Java内部的字符串可以说是没有编码的,只有bytes[]有编码!但是java平台是有编码的,编码为平台(操作系统)默认编码,但是对于别的平台如数据库、文件、网页(浏览器)等,编码不一样!调用Charset.defaultCharset(): import java.n
转载 2023-09-14 22:01:19
251阅读
ucenter的中文问题终于解决,这也暴露我对Java编码知识的严重不足,经过多次试验和搜索,对这块知识终于有了一个新的认识,所以把理解的内容写道这里1:JVM的内存中字符串的编码格式是统一的吗?JVM里面的任何字符串资源都是Unicode,String相当于 char[] 。 而JVM中的byte[]是带编码的,比如,Big5,GBK,GB2312,UTF-8之类的。一个GBK编码的b
转载 2024-07-23 18:00:51
44阅读
导入工程时经常会看到一些中文注释出现乱码,这是比较头疼的。这里总结下Eclipse编码设置方法。如果要使插件开发应用能有更好的国际化支持,能够最大程度的支持中文输出,则最好使Java文件使用UTF-8编码。然而,Eclipse工作空间(workspace)的缺省字符编码是操作系统缺省的编码,简体中文操作系统(Windows XP、Windows2000简体中文)的缺省编码是GB18030,在此工作
# 如何设置FileReader的编码 ## 1. 整体流程 在Java设置FileReader的编码是一项常见的操作,特别是在处理不同编码的文本文件时。首先我们需要创建一个FileReader对象,然后通过InputStreamReader来设置编码。接下来就可以使用FileReader对象来读取文件内容了。 下面是设置FileReader编码的具体步骤表格: | 步骤 | 操作 |
原创 2024-06-13 04:07:14
340阅读
其实对于初学者,最忌讳的一个事就是在学习过程中,认为自己是新手,代码可以随便写!但是事实上并不是如此!因为一个人的编码规范是从开始学的时候就必须要练习和养成习惯的!从编码过程中的每一件小事做起!从我们初学的时候的变量、方法名、类名等做起!不要看不起这一段代码!其实大牛与小白写代码,除了思维上的差距外,其编码风格也是重中之重!可能两个人写相同的一段逻辑!小白写的,别人可能要花上10分钟去读取,而大牛
Java之IO系列--文件的字符编码
# Java设置ANSI编码Java中,我们经常需要处理不同的字符编码,包括ANSI编码。ANSI是一种字符编码标准,常见于Windows操作系统中。在处理ANSI编码时,我们可能会遇到乱码或者编码转换的问题。为了正确处理ANSI编码,我们需要设置正确的字符编码方式。下面我们将介绍如何在Java设置ANSI编码,并提供一些代码示例。 ## 设置ANSI编码Java中,我们可以使用`
原创 2024-03-01 06:53:22
142阅读
  • 1
  • 2
  • 3
  • 4
  • 5